The Empress of Little Rock Bed and Breakfast
Little Rock, AR 72206
This bed and breakfast is housed inside a Victorian style residence and is said to be haunted by a male ghost who dresses well. He has been spotted on the stairs and in various other rooms throughout the place. A large ghostly woman wearing pink is also known to stand outside guest rooms. The apparition of an old sea captain has been seen in a number of the guest rooms, and an African American maid is known to linger in the maid's closet. Phantom footsteps have also been heard, and doors are said to open and close on their own.
